Sure, your Silverado pickup truck may be fast but you can make it even faster by investing on Chevy Silverado tonneau covers. It does more than just protect your goods in truck bed. As you know, open truck beds catch some of that airflow in the tailgate, thus slowing your truck a bit and eating up some of the gas. By getting a tonneau cover that fits your truck bed, you eradicate the chances of tailgate drag as air only passes by your vehicle without catching some of that air flow. This then saves you about 10% on gas mileage.
